Role Summary/Purpose

US Clinical Education Coordinator is a link between customers and Application Specialists US department. He/she is responsible for leading Application Specialists US department and planning their work.
Essential Responsibilities

US Clinical Education Coordinator is charged with the following employment duties:

•Take incoming customer calls and log the problem in the appropriate tool (if required);
•Identify contractual commitments, accurate use of remote support;
•Cooperation with Freelancers, including booking tickets;
•IPP&SSP tracking (Improper payment prevention and Independent Service Provider);
•Identify accurate use of Application Specialists’ diary and use of the escalation plan;
•Coordinate and optimize the day to day activity of Application Specialists required to meet the customer demands;
•Take incoming calls from Application Specialists related to dispatching;
•Track all activities through the company’s system and monitor training completion rate;
•Enter all comments and agree action plan, offer suggestions on possible solutions;
•Use the training records and maps to find a suitable resource;
•Close Communication with Installation Specialists, Op Center Administrator and Op Center Coordinators to ensure all Application Specialists requests are included within the Application Specialists Resource Management process;
•Lead Application Specialists’ initiatives & establish clear processes for proper/quality & on-time planning;
•Planning of AppsLinq training in proper time frames accordingly contracts obligation;
•Metrics analysis;
•Application trainings back log reduction.
